Position Summary

Epiq's Cyber Incident Response group is responsible for managing and overseeing review of data exfiltrated in cyber incidents to identify, extract, and report on the individuals whose personal identifying information (PII) and protected health information (PHI) were compromised. The Review Manager must have a general understanding of data entry, document review, and project management. The Review Manager must be consultative and able to interface with clients and partners, including, corporations, law firms, forensics vendors, and insurers. The Review Manager must be able to effectively maintain a caseload including multiple active matters. Cyber specific review management experience is not necessary.

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Serve as primary point of contact for clients during cyber incident response review projects.
  • Conduct project design meetings and consult with clients on the development and implementation of efficient and effective workflows for data mining and capture related to data exfiltration.
  • Determine and manage client expectations regarding deliverables and timeframes.
  • Draft workflow protocols and substantive training guidelines in partnership with the client and counsel, including the review and data capture related to large documents unable to be captured within standard review tools.
  • Implement review workflows, including the creation of assignments, fields, choices, rules, and access security.
  • Leverage the appropriate technology to improve productivity and accuracy.
  • Execute quality control and quality assurance best practices, including the use of statistical sampling, advanced searching techniques, and application of custom scripts.
  • Communicate and document substantive issues to client and counsel through the creation and maintenance of a query log.
  • Monitor and report daily on overall progress, productivity, and accuracy of the project and individual team members, including performance to budget.
  • Lead and motivate review teams comprised of both attorneys and non-attorneys.
  • Train reviewers on the use of review platforms, including the identification and mentoring of team leaders.
  • Work with both US and Global review teams and clients.

Qualifications:

  • Minimum 2 years of project or review management experience.
  • Extensive experience with the administration of review databases, including Relativity.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office, particularly Excel and the use of formulas, pivot tables, and basic formatting.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, including experience leading conference calls and meetings with colleagues and clients.
  • Excellent issue spotting and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Experience with delivering difficult projects on time and within budget.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
